Choosing the right platform for your e-commerce venture is a critical decision that can significantly impact your business's success. Two of the most popular options are Shopify and WordPress. Both have their unique strengths and weaknesses, making the choice between Shopify vs WordPress a nuanced one. This blog post will delve into the key differences, advantages, and disadvantages of each platform to help you make an informed decision.

Understanding Shopify

Shopify is a comprehensive e-commerce platform designed specifically for online stores. It offers a wide range of features that cater to both beginners and experienced entrepreneurs. Shopify's user-friendly interface and robust support make it a popular choice for those looking to set up an online store quickly and efficiently.

Key Features of Shopify

  • Ease of Use: Shopify is known for its intuitive and easy-to-use interface. Even those with minimal technical skills can create a professional-looking online store.
  • Hosting and Security: Shopify provides hosting and security features, ensuring your site is always up and running and protected from threats.
  • Payment Gateways: Shopify supports multiple payment gateways, including its own Shopify Payments, which simplifies the checkout process.
  • App Store: The Shopify App Store offers a vast array of plugins and extensions to enhance your store's functionality.
  • Customer Support: Shopify offers 24/7 customer support through live chat, email, and phone, ensuring you get help whenever you need it.

Pros and Cons of Shopify

Before diving into the specifics, let's outline the pros and cons of using Shopify.

Pros Cons
User-friendly interface Limited customization options
Built-in hosting and security Transaction fees for third-party payment gateways
Extensive app store Higher costs for advanced features
24/7 customer support Limited blogging capabilities

Understanding WordPress

WordPress is a versatile content management system (CMS) that powers millions of websites worldwide. While it is primarily known for blogging, WordPress can also be transformed into a powerful e-commerce platform with the help of plugins like WooCommerce. This flexibility makes it a popular choice for those who want more control over their website's design and functionality.

Key Features of WordPress

  • Flexibility and Customization: WordPress offers unparalleled flexibility and customization options. With thousands of themes and plugins available, you can tailor your site to meet your specific needs.
  • SEO-Friendly: WordPress is known for its SEO-friendly structure, making it easier to optimize your site for search engines.
  • Blogging Capabilities: WordPress excels in blogging, making it an excellent choice for content-driven e-commerce sites.
  • Community Support: WordPress has a large and active community, providing ample resources and support for users.
  • Cost-Effective: WordPress is open-source and free to use, although you may incur costs for hosting, themes, and plugins.

Pros and Cons of WordPress

Let's take a look at the pros and cons of using WordPress for e-commerce.

Pros Cons
Highly customizable Requires more technical knowledge
SEO-friendly Security concerns
Strong blogging capabilities Additional costs for plugins and themes
Large community support No built-in hosting or security

Shopify vs WordPress: A Detailed Comparison

Now that we have a basic understanding of both platforms, let's dive into a detailed comparison of Shopify vs WordPress.

Ease of Use

When it comes to ease of use, Shopify is the clear winner. Its intuitive interface and drag-and-drop builder make it easy for beginners to set up an online store without any technical knowledge. WordPress, on the other hand, requires a bit more technical know-how, especially if you want to customize your site extensively.

Customization Options

WordPress offers far more customization options than Shopify. With access to thousands of themes and plugins, you can create a unique and highly functional e-commerce site. Shopify, while customizable, has limitations compared to WordPress. However, Shopify's App Store provides a wide range of plugins to enhance your store's functionality.

Hosting and Security

Shopify provides built-in hosting and security features, ensuring your site is always up and running and protected from threats. WordPress, being a self-hosted platform, requires you to manage your own hosting and security. This can be a disadvantage for those who lack technical expertise but offers more control for experienced users.

πŸ”’ Note: If you choose WordPress, make sure to select a reliable hosting provider and implement robust security measures to protect your site.

Payment Gateways

Shopify supports multiple payment gateways, including its own Shopify Payments, which simplifies the checkout process. WordPress, with the help of WooCommerce, also supports a variety of payment gateways. However, setting up payment gateways in WordPress can be more complex compared to Shopify.

Customer Support

Shopify offers 24/7 customer support through live chat, email, and phone, ensuring you get help whenever you need it. WordPress, being an open-source platform, relies on community support. While there are plenty of resources and forums available, you may not get the same level of personalized support as with Shopify.

Cost

Shopify's pricing plans range from $29 to $299 per month, depending on the features you need. WordPress is free to use, but you may incur costs for hosting, themes, and plugins. The total cost can vary widely depending on your specific needs and the level of customization you require.

SEO Capabilities

WordPress is known for its SEO-friendly structure, making it easier to optimize your site for search engines. Shopify also offers SEO features, but WordPress generally provides more flexibility and control over SEO.

Blogging Capabilities

WordPress excels in blogging, making it an excellent choice for content-driven e-commerce sites. Shopify also offers blogging capabilities, but they are not as robust as WordPress. If blogging is a crucial part of your e-commerce strategy, WordPress is the better choice.

When to Choose Shopify

Shopify is an excellent choice for those who:

  • Want a user-friendly platform with minimal technical knowledge required.
  • Need built-in hosting and security features.
  • Prefer a platform specifically designed for e-commerce.
  • Require 24/7 customer support.
  • Want a quick and easy setup process.

When to Choose WordPress

WordPress is a better fit for those who:

  • Need a highly customizable platform.
  • Have some technical knowledge or are willing to learn.
  • Require strong blogging capabilities.
  • Want more control over SEO and site optimization.
  • Prefer a cost-effective solution with open-source software.

In conclusion, the choice between Shopify vs WordPress depends on your specific needs, technical expertise, and budget. Shopify is ideal for those who want a user-friendly, all-in-one e-commerce solution, while WordPress offers more flexibility and customization for those willing to invest the time and effort. Both platforms have their strengths and weaknesses, so consider your priorities and choose the one that best aligns with your business goals.
